2004 Big Bear 400 idles too high
#2
Could be the choke sticking or a crack in the inlet manifold, but if it has happened gradually, your throttle stop may need altering. Check that there is some slack in the throttle cable, then adjust the throttle stop screw, which is usually a big black plastic **** under the carburettor, often has a flexible cable from it to the side of the throttle cable cover on the carb, screw out to lower the idle speed.
